School Project – Belgrove Senior Girls National School, Dublin

At Belgrove Senior Girls National School, the goal was to deliver a durable, safe outdoor surface that could support daily use by pupils across multiple areas of the school grounds. The project included several courtyards and play zones, incorporating colour, movement, and structure while maintaining safety underfoot. Designed to withstand heavy footfall and Ireland’s weather, the finished space supports both active play and calmer outdoor time throughout the school year.

Home Putting Green – County Kerry

This Kerry home putting green was designed for realistic play and year-round performance in a residential setting. Integrated seamlessly into the garden, the surface allows for both putting and pitching practice while remaining practical for everyday use. The installation balances performance with appearance, providing a specialist feature that still feels at home in the wider garden environment.

Domestic Garden – Hard Surface Installation, Galway

This Galway garden project involved transforming a previously hard, impractical outdoor area into a clean, usable space suitable for everyday living. Installed over an existing hard surface, the artificial grass created a softer, more welcoming finish while keeping maintenance low. The result is a garden that works in all seasons and feels like a natural extension of the home rather than an afterthought.

Commercial & Community – Dolphin House Community Centre, Dublin

The Dolphin House Community Centre project focused on creating a robust, low-maintenance surface for a shared community space with constant daily use. Reliability and safety were key considerations, as the area needed to cater for a wide range of users and activities. The completed installation provides a clean, durable surface that supports the centre’s role as a well-used and welcoming community hub.
